blogic b7fc892eb5 lantiq: move partitions into partion table node
Starting with kernel 4.4, the use of partitions as direct subnodes of the
mtd device is discouraged and only supported for backward compatiblity
reasons.

/dts-v1/;
/include/ "VGV7510KW22.dtsi"
/ {
fpi@10000000 {
localbus@0 {
nor-boot@0 {
partitions {
partition@0 {
label = "Boot";
reg = <0x00000 0x40000>;
read-only;
};
partition@40000 {
label = "Configuration";
reg = <0x40000 0x40000>;
read-only;
};
partition@80000 {
label = "Certificate";
reg = <0x80000 0x20000>;
read-only;
};
partition@a0000 {
label = "Special_Area";
reg = <0xa0000 0x20000>;
read-only;
};
partition@c0000 {
label = "Primary_Setting";
reg = <0xc0000 0x20000>;
read-only;
};
partition@e0000 {
label = "firmware"; /* "Code Image 0" in OFW */
reg = <0xe0000 0x780000>;
read-only;
};
partition@860000 {
label = "Code_Image_1";
reg = <0x860000 0x780000>;
read-only;
};
};
};
};
};
};
